Today’s guest post comes from Angie Franks, CEO at Kalderos. Angie examines how data fragmentation contributes to inefficiencies in drug discount programs and the broader gross-to-net bubble—the widening difference between a drug’s revenue at list prices and what manufacturers actually receive.
